期刊文献+
共找到13篇文章
< 1 >
每页显示 20 50 100
基于RISC-V的SM2点乘运算协处理器设计
1
作者 孙子婷 韩跃平 唐道光 《单片机与嵌入式系统应用》 2023年第8期28-31,共4页
针对SM2国密算法在有限域上大数运算结构复杂、运算开销大的问题,通过研究SM2国密算法在二元扩域下的椭圆曲线点乘运算及其相关基础运算,设计了一种基于RISC-V指令集的椭圆曲线点乘运算加速协处理器。协处理器采用三级流水线结构,提高... 针对SM2国密算法在有限域上大数运算结构复杂、运算开销大的问题,通过研究SM2国密算法在二元扩域下的椭圆曲线点乘运算及其相关基础运算,设计了一种基于RISC-V指令集的椭圆曲线点乘运算加速协处理器。协处理器采用三级流水线结构,提高了计算效率。处理器内部集成9条自定义指令,可协助支持RISC-V的主处理器快速完成SM2国密算法。Vivado仿真结果表明,本设计各流水级功能正常,将协处理器烧录至Xilinx XC7A100T FPGA上,在200 MHz频率下运行结果正确,达到预期目标。 展开更多
关键词 RISC-V 协处理器 运算 二元扩域
下载PDF
使用混合坐标系统改进椭圆曲线上的运算速度 被引量:1
2
作者 张燕燕 《信息技术》 2004年第9期38-40,44,共4页
椭圆曲线密码体制有着巨大的发展前景,然而其运算速度限制了它在实际应用中的发展。本文综合分析了仿射坐标系统、影射坐标系统、雅可比坐标系统、五元素雅可比坐标系统在加法和倍点运算上的优缺点,提出了一个改进的雅可比坐标系统,并... 椭圆曲线密码体制有着巨大的发展前景,然而其运算速度限制了它在实际应用中的发展。本文综合分析了仿射坐标系统、影射坐标系统、雅可比坐标系统、五元素雅可比坐标系统在加法和倍点运算上的优缺点,提出了一个改进的雅可比坐标系统,并且建议使用混合的坐标系统来改进椭圆曲线上的加法和倍点运算的速度。 展开更多
关键词 混合坐标系统 椭圆曲线 公钥密码体制 雅可比坐标系统 运算
下载PDF
椭圆曲线密码运算效率提高的算法实现
3
作者 张家喜 《宿州学院学报》 2006年第3期121-123,共3页
本文针对椭圆曲线密码系统的算法高速实现,讨论了对椭圆曲线上的点的加法和倍点运算,以及对点的标量乘法运算进行优化的技术,可以大大提高整个椭圆曲线密码系统的算法实现性能。
关键词 椭圆曲线密码系统 数乘运算 的加法 运算 标量乘法
下载PDF
F2^n上基于ONB的椭圆曲线乘法器的设计与实现 被引量:2
4
作者 朱璇 陈韬 郁滨 《微电子学与计算机》 CSCD 北大核心 2005年第7期184-188,共5页
文章在介绍有限域运算法则,域上椭圆曲线及点的运算法则的基础上,设计了一个F1291上基于优化正规基的串行椭圆曲线乘法器,其点乘运算速度可达80.87次/秒,为进一步完成椭圆曲线加密系统提供了硬件基础。
关键词 椭圆曲线 正规基 运算 点倍运算
下载PDF
素数域椭圆曲线密码系统算法实现研究 被引量:3
5
作者 唐文 陈钟 +2 位作者 南相浩 段云所 唐礼勇 《计算机工程》 CAS CSCD 北大核心 2003年第16期6-7,10,共3页
针对素数域椭圆曲线密码系统的算法高速实现,分别讨论了对椭圆曲线上的点的加法和倍点运算,以及对点的标量乘法运算进行优化的技术,同时给出了测试比较结果,说明了所讨论的优化技术可以大大提高整个椭圆曲线密码系统的算法实现性能。
关键词 椭圆曲线密码系统 的加法 运算 标量乘法 不相邻格式 滑动窗口
下载PDF
GF(2~m)域SM2算法的实现与优化 被引量:10
6
作者 黄世中 《信息网络安全》 2012年第1期36-39,共4页
文章从有限域的基本运算和有限域上多倍点运算两个方面讨论分析了GF(2m)域SM2多倍点运算的实现算法和优化技巧,并给出了一个模一般三项式求余式的算法。实践表明运用这些算法和技巧,可以有效地提高多倍点运算的运行速度。
关键词 运算 三项式 欧几里得算法变体 混合坐标系 加减法
下载PDF
素数域椭圆曲线密码在智能卡上的设计与实现 被引量:4
7
作者 于涛 叶顶锋 《计算机仿真》 CSCD 北大核心 2009年第3期132-135,共4页
椭圆曲线密码体制具有密钥短,安全性高的特点,十分适合在智能卡上使用。针对智能卡存储与计算能力有限的特点,分析了选择素数域椭圆曲线密码的原因,并提出一种基于RSA基本运算的ECC实现方案。通过该方案,可以利用已有的RSA智能卡平台所... 椭圆曲线密码体制具有密钥短,安全性高的特点,十分适合在智能卡上使用。针对智能卡存储与计算能力有限的特点,分析了选择素数域椭圆曲线密码的原因,并提出一种基于RSA基本运算的ECC实现方案。通过该方案,可以利用已有的RSA智能卡平台所提供的运算协处理器实现素数域上的ECC算法。详细分析了椭圆曲线密码实现过程中的各个细节,并针对倍点与点加这两个基本运算,设计出针对智能卡的实现方案,该方案可以最大程度节省智能卡存储空间。最后给出了素数域椭圆曲线签名算法在智能卡上实现的实验数据,证明设计的实现方案是高效的。 展开更多
关键词 椭圆曲线密码 智能卡 运算 运算 素数域
下载PDF
椭圆曲线密码处理器的高效VLSI设计与实现 被引量:2
8
作者 韩永相 白国强 陈弘毅 《微电子学与计算机》 CSCD 北大核心 2007年第12期1-5,共5页
采用复合式硬件设计方法,通过数学公式推导和电路结构设计,完成了一款GF(2m)域椭圆曲线密码处理器的高效VLSI实现。以低成本为目标,对算术逻辑模块的乘法、约减、平方、求逆,以及控制电路模块都进行了优化设计。按照椭圆曲线密码的不同... 采用复合式硬件设计方法,通过数学公式推导和电路结构设计,完成了一款GF(2m)域椭圆曲线密码处理器的高效VLSI实现。以低成本为目标,对算术逻辑模块的乘法、约减、平方、求逆,以及控制电路模块都进行了优化设计。按照椭圆曲线密码的不同运算层次,设计了不同层次的控制电路。该处理器综合在中芯国际SMIC0.18μm标准工艺库上,比相关研究的芯片面积节省48%,同时保证了很快的速度。 展开更多
关键词 椭圆曲线密码(ECC) 有限域算术 运算 VLSI实现
下载PDF
Fp域SM2算法的实现与优化
9
作者 黄世中 《电脑编程技巧与维护》 2012年第2期110-111,132,共3页
从基本运算和多倍点运算两个方面,讨论了SM2多倍点运算的实现算法和优化技巧。
关键词 运算 混合坐标系 加减法
下载PDF
椭圆曲线密码的三元算法
10
作者 张静 辛小龙 《计算机应用与软件》 CSCD 北大核心 2007年第12期54-56,共3页
基于离散对数问题的椭圆曲线公钥密码体制越来越倍受关注。在该体制中,因最耗时的运算是椭圆曲线上的点与一个整数的乘法运算,所以倍点运算的快速算法是椭圆曲线密码快速实现的关键。利用整数的有符号的三元展开,实现了椭圆曲线密码的... 基于离散对数问题的椭圆曲线公钥密码体制越来越倍受关注。在该体制中,因最耗时的运算是椭圆曲线上的点与一个整数的乘法运算,所以倍点运算的快速算法是椭圆曲线密码快速实现的关键。利用整数的有符号的三元展开,实现了椭圆曲线密码的快速算法,其效率比二元算法提高12.4%。 展开更多
关键词 椭圆曲线 三元展开 运算
下载PDF
椭圆曲线联合稀疏表算法的一种改进
11
作者 任中岗 翟东海 《信息与电子工程》 2009年第6期613-616,共4页
为了提高基于椭圆曲线密码系统的各种运算效率,提出了一种椭圆曲线上联合稀疏表(JSF)算法的改进算法,并对改进算法的运算效率进行了分析。分析结果表明,与改进前相比,该改进算法平均可以减少0.37次倍点运算,从而使总的运算量达到更低,... 为了提高基于椭圆曲线密码系统的各种运算效率,提出了一种椭圆曲线上联合稀疏表(JSF)算法的改进算法,并对改进算法的运算效率进行了分析。分析结果表明,与改进前相比,该改进算法平均可以减少0.37次倍点运算,从而使总的运算量达到更低,而运算效率更高。如果以现有加密强度来衡量的话,算法效率可以提高0.15%。 展开更多
关键词 椭圆曲线 双标量乘 运算 联合稀疏表算法
下载PDF
椭圆曲线数字签名算法中的快速验证算法 被引量:11
12
作者 白国强 黄谆 陈弘毅 《清华大学学报(自然科学版)》 EI CAS CSCD 北大核心 2003年第4期564-568,共5页
Montgomery方法是椭圆曲线密码中计算多倍点运算 k P的一种新方法。为减少在椭圆曲线数字签名算法验证过程中需完成的 k P+l Q的计算量 ,该文在分析 Mont-gom ery方法的基础上 ,将计算 k P和计算 l Q的流程结合在一起 ,提出了一种计算... Montgomery方法是椭圆曲线密码中计算多倍点运算 k P的一种新方法。为减少在椭圆曲线数字签名算法验证过程中需完成的 k P+l Q的计算量 ,该文在分析 Mont-gom ery方法的基础上 ,将计算 k P和计算 l Q的流程结合在一起 ,提出了一种计算多倍点运算 k P+l Q的新算法 ,使椭圆曲线数字签名算法中验证签名所需的计算量减少了2 5 %。新算法对改善椭圆曲线密码的实现技术具有一定意义。 展开更多
关键词 椭圆曲线密码 椭圆曲线数字签名算法 Montgomery方法 运算 验证算法
原文传递
斐波那契数列在标量乘法中的应用
13
作者 李磊 《网络安全技术与应用》 2015年第12期53-55,共3页
0引言 随着Kobilitz和Millier提出将椭圆曲线应用到公钥加密体系中以来,椭圆曲线逐渐被广泛应用于越来越多的领域。由于椭圆曲线具有高比特的安全性,所以在资源有限的环境中更能得到广泛的应用,例如应用在智能卡和嵌入式设备中。椭圆曲... 0引言 随着Kobilitz和Millier提出将椭圆曲线应用到公钥加密体系中以来,椭圆曲线逐渐被广泛应用于越来越多的领域。由于椭圆曲线具有高比特的安全性,所以在资源有限的环境中更能得到广泛的应用,例如应用在智能卡和嵌入式设备中。椭圆曲线计算中的一个很重要的操作就是点的标量乘法运算,例如计算k P,其中k是标量,P是椭圆曲线上的任意一点。 展开更多
关键词 标量乘法 斐波那契数 椭圆曲线 公钥加密 嵌入式设备 计算机密码学 现代密码学 cryptography 加法运算 运算
原文传递
上一页 1 下一页 到第
使用帮助 返回顶部